The Behaviour & Ethics team (part of Compliance/SIM – Resilience & Prevention) plays an important role in strengthening an enabling work climate within ABN AMRO. An organization where doing the right thing is at the heart of every decision and action.
We are looking for a Domain Expert within the Behaviour & Ethics team who not only helps anticipate and mitigate behavioural risks, but also enables the organization to learn from incidents and integrity breaches. By identifying behavioural and cultural root causes and translating insights into lessons learned and behavioural interventions, you help prevent recurrence and strengthen the organization’s risk culture and resilience. You will contribute to safeguarding an enabling work environment where colleagues are empowered to do the right thing and where a sound risk mindset is central.
You conduct behavioural research to identify barriers to desired behaviour and root causes of undesired behaviour, integrity breaches and other manifestations of behavioural risk. You analyse where behavioural drivers or patterns contribute to these issues and translate these insights into lessons learned, targeted interventions, practical advice and other improvements.
Using evidence-based behavioural science approaches, you design, test and measure behavioural interventions to ensure effective results. In doing so, you help address root causes rather than symptoms, reduce the likelihood of recurrence and enable the organization to learn from incidents and integrity breaches.
As a research lead, you manage behavioural research projects and ensure a structured and strategic approach. You apply scientific methods and techniques to make behaviour measurable, including qualitative and quantitative research, interview and conversation techniques, surveys, and the soft control framework (conduct drivers).
You set strategic priorities for behavioural research and provide ad-hoc advice by translating insights into a broader organizational context.
Collaboration is key: you work closely with various disciplines inside and outside Compliance & SIM, including HR, client units, and other stakeholders. Through this collaboration, you ensure an integrated approach that leverages behavioural insights to strengthen risk culture and promote a supportive work environment. You help embed behavioural knowledge and change into the organization’s way of working.
The Behaviour & Ethics team (6 FTE) is part of Compliance & SIM | SIM Resilience & Prevention and has a mission to build a resilient organization where doing the right thing—beyond mere compliance—is at the heart of every decision and action. To achieve this, the team promotes a supportive work environment and activates ethical reflection through initiatives such as the code of conduct, the Ethics Council, dilemma dialogues, and methodologies to identify, mitigate, and prevent behavioural risks.
